Patriots Release Four Players Ahead of 2025 NFL Draft
The New England Patriots have made significant roster changes, releasing four players: offensive tackle Caleb Jones, center Lecitus Smith, and linebackers Curtis Jacobs and Andrew Parker Jr. These cuts reduce the roster to 69 players ahead of the 2025 NFL Draft, leaving 21 spots open on the 90-man roster. Smith, who was signed from the Packers' practice squad, played in eight games last season, while Jacobs, claimed off waivers from the Chiefs, appeared in nine games primarily on special teams. Jones joined the Patriots' practice squad in September and did not see any game action, while Parker was signed to the practice squad in December after going undrafted. These moves are part of a broader effort by head coach Mike Vrabel to reshape the team, as the Patriots have also signed several new players this month. The organization continues to transition its roster following a challenging season.
